1. Choose the Right Type of Balloons for Outdoor Use


Not all balloons are created equal. For outdoor events, we use high-quality latex and foil balloons specifically designed to handle UV exposure, temperature shifts, and wind. Lower-grade materials can pop, fade, or deflate quickly in the sun.

2. Timing and Temperature Matter


Balloon décor reacts to the environment. Direct sunlight, high humidity, and temperature changes can cause expansion and popping if not accounted for.


✅ Morning setups are ideal for mid-day parties

✅ Shade is your friend—if it’s available, use it!

✅ We recommend neutral or pastel colors for daytime events to reduce heat absorption

3. Anchor Everything—Wind is Always a Factor


Even on the calmest day, a surprise gust of wind can knock over lightweight décor. That’s why we secure every installation with internal framing, weighted bases, and heavy-duty anchors—especially for balloon columns, arches, and poolside displays.

4. Expect Some Expansion—And Plan for It


As temperatures rise, balloons expand. Indoors, it’s not a big deal. Outdoors? It can lead to popping if your balloons aren’t inflated correctly. We always adjust inflation levels for outdoor environments so your décor lasts throughout the event.

5. Think About Your Event Flow & Photo Ops


Outdoor balloon décor should be both functional and fabulous. For example:


📸 Arches at entrances help guests know where to go—and create perfect photo ops

🎈 Tent décor softens the look of blank space and adds color to meal areas

🌴 Themed displays (like palm trees or balloon floats) instantly elevate pool parties or luaus

🎉 Balloon wind waivers make festivals feel festive and help with visibility from a distance

What Highly Organized Venues Do Differently The most organized venues share a few key traits. They have clear rules for load in and load out, defined setup windows, and staff who know exactly how events should flow. Vendors receive instructions early, not on the day of the event. Floor plans are accurate, access points are clear, and timelines are realistic. This level of structure allows creative teams to focus on design instead of problem solving. When everyone knows where to be and when, installs are faster, safer, and cleaner.
